What interests did prevail, within the main Italian state-owned electric power company, regarding the two issues of electricity tariffs and nationalisation? This article argues that, to answer this question, it is necessary to consider both the “political” and the more directly “economic” interests of Sip. In particular, the article explores the latter, focusing on the fundamental elements of financial sources, production structure, and results achieved. This analysis helps to explain the position taken by the state-owned company on the two main issues that affected the Italian electric industry in the period between 1945 and 1962.
